Quick update regarding LFG and team up requests for Modern Warfare II.

There is a LFG Forum within our Discord community dedicated to a selected number of older games, including Modern Warfare II.

There are three specific posts for the game:

  • [MW2] Modern Warfare II - Multiplayer
  • [MW2] Modern Warfare II - Special Ops // Raids
  • [MW2] Modern Warfare II - DMZ Beta

Discussion MWII has the perfect TTK & playing newer cods made me realize how special it is

94 Upvotes

Now, I've played MWII for 3/400 hours through MWIII and BO6 life cycle, thinking it was good but mostly just MW19 with better maps, even better animations and a sort of "milsim" tone that I do like, and also thinking "any cod multiplayer is as good as any other" (im more of a campaign guy - I'll leave that part of the game out of this conversation, I'll just say the only 3 good campaigns from 2020 onwards are Cold War, BO6 barely, and MWII) so I just didnt feel the need to buy a newer one.

Lately though Ive tried Black Ops 6, MWIII (went free with PS Plus) and the MW4 beta weekend 2. And playing them made me realize how MWII is even better than I thought and how special it actually is.

The first one I played after MWII was BO6. I didnt like it because it has the issue of the ruined aesthetics (which Ill talk about in the MWIII section) and it also has what I call brainrot maps. Insanely small maps where theres no space for skill or positioning or anything, just spawn run kill die repeat. But here I thought "its just treyarch making a bad copy of an IW game, it's happened before". Gunplay also feels more "gamey" compared to MWII.

Then I played MWIII. It's mainly here that I realized how good MWII is for me. Before playing I thought "its MWII with more content, theres no way I dont like it" but no. 1) The TTK is unbearably long 2) therefore weapons feel weak, in contrast with the whole intention behind the realistic, heavy animations, models, VFX. 3) I would argue the game feels slower than MWII because it takes half an hour to kill one person. 4) TTK aside, the game feels like a cheap clone of MWII which does indeed fix some issues but is completely soulless, throws some random new content in there and calls it a day. 5) It also fucks up the aesthetics with an unbearable amount of animated and whacky skins. Anytime i grabbed a gun off the floor there was some dumb shit on it.

At this point I even thought "maybe I didnt like MWII that much to begin with" so I went back and played it again,

And dude. It's so good. The TTK is perfect. Weapons feel great. Maps have room to breathe, but not too much on some Derail type shit. Weapons arsenal feels intentional and guns have a role compared to MWIII. You can experiment with different loadouts since with this TTK if you're good youre gonna be good even if you dont run the sweatiest shit in the game.

Then I played the MW4 beta just a couple days ago when it was live and I was also disappointed because the TTK felt long (only played weekend 2) and the maps felt chaotic and small here too. Gunplay was satisfying but maps are so bad it's pointless.

So yeah, playing the newer games made me appreciate MWII even more.
